American military bases remain dangerously vulnerable to swarms of small, inexpensive attack drones, according to one of the senior commanders responsible for defending the homeland.
Army Lt. Gen. Joseph Jarrard warned that domestic installations are currently “ill-equipped” to stop the kind of coordinated drone strikes already being used around the world.
Jarrard serves as deputy commander of U.S. Northern Command and vice commander of the American contingent of North American Aerospace Defense Command.
Speaking Thursday at the annual Space and Missile Defense Symposium, he said the military is developing new tactics but is “not there yet” on reliable base protection.
The most immediate problem is not merely shooting drones down after they arrive.
Military forces must first detect, identify, and track potentially large swarms before those systems reach runways, aircraft, ammunition sites, command facilities, or other critical targets.
“We don’t have the sensors, and depending on where that swarm is going to attack, it depends on whether we have any sensors at all, and also whether we’ve got any effectors to go after that problem,” Jarrard said. That is a blunt admission about a threat that offers commanders little room for error.
A drone warfare guide released this summer by Joint Interagency Task Force 401 delivered an equally stark assessment. It warned that “once a drone is overhead, the most important decisions about protection and countermeasures have already been made or, as it were, missed.”
That reality makes early warning essential because a small drone can approach at low altitude, maneuver around obstacles, and strike with little notice.
A swarm makes the challenge worse by overwhelming sensors and forcing defenders to engage numerous inexpensive targets at once.
The military is testing several approaches to counter the growing danger, including directed energy weapons, specialized ammunition, and compact missile launchers designed to destroy fast moving drones.
American forces are also working to incorporate small unmanned systems into offensive operations, recognizing that drones are now central to modern warfare rather than some battlefield novelty.
The cost problem remains brutal for defenders because launching an expensive interceptor against a cheap drone is not a sustainable formula.
Adversaries can therefore use numbers to exhaust defensive magazines, distract security teams, and punch holes in protection around high value military infrastructure.
Ukraine demonstrated the destructive potential last year during Operation Spider’s Web, which carried dozens of one way attack drones deep into Russian territory aboard commercial trucks.
Once positioned, the drones emerged from containers and inflicted extensive damage on Russian military facilities far from the expected front lines.
That operation offered another warning to American planners: hostile drones do not necessarily need to cross an international border under military control.
They can be concealed, transported near a target, and launched from inside the country, making traditional perimeter defenses look painfully outdated.
Iranian forces also targeted American positions in the Middle East with missiles and drones during this year’s Iran war.
In March, small first person view drones operated by an Iranian backed militia attacked an American air base in Baghdad, with militia video showing one system surveying the installation before slamming into its target.
“We are ill-equipped right now to handle something like that, and obviously we’ve seen it used,” Jarrard told the audience. He added, “We’re seeing it used on a daily basis around the world, and we’ve got to figure out how to mitigate that threat.”
The Army is expected to add laser weapons to its base defense arsenal soon, according to a source familiar with the effort.
The War Department plans to place lasers and other directed energy systems at no fewer than five bases by the end of the year.
Laser systems could give defenders a less expensive way to engage repeated drone attacks without burning through limited missile inventories. However, weather, power requirements, tracking limitations, and the sheer number of possible targets mean no single piece of technology will solve the entire problem.
